Hardspace: Shipbreaker Overview

Step into the shoes of a shipbreaker at LYNX, the galaxy’s prominent ship-salvaging corporation in "Hardspace: Shipbreaker." Your task involves buying salvaging rights to diverse ships, progressively larger and more valuable, to pay off your debt. By meticulously cutting open these ships, your goal is to extract maximum value from the wreckage. Dive into the challenging world of space salvaging where precision and strategy are key to success.

Immerse yourself in this simulation game that offers a unique experience of deconstructing spacecraft and salvaging components for profit. With a focus on detail and resource management, "Hardspace: Shipbreaker" presents a compelling gameplay loop that will test your skills and decision-making abilities.
